Both candidates exceeded expectations.  However, the overall winner was Biden, both because he looked the part and because there was no major knockout punch.

Trump was controlled, quick on the feet and reasonably civil.  While his misleading accusations and outright lies were cringeworthy, they may actually help him with less informed voters.

Biden was mostly composed, focused and substantive, and certainly looked and sounded more presidential.  For policy wonks, he clearly committed to significant policies and showed his understanding of the issues.

Ultimately, Trump needed a knockout and it just didn't happen.  He will pick up a few wavering republicans, but will still trail Biden by 8-10%, simply not enough to win key swing states.

Short of a major, major surprise, this election is now pretty much over - it will likely be a landslide for Biden!
